Karrie Neurauter, 20, has admitted driving her father to her mother's house and distracting her 14-year-old younger sister while he strangled his ex-wife.
Neurauter has pleaded guilty to second degree murder in a deal which will see her testify against her father, Lloyd Neurauter, 45, in exchange for a recommended sentence of 15 years to life.
The upstate New York uni student says she helped her dad make the scene look like her mum Michele, 46, had taken her own life, reports News.com.au.
Karrie Neurauter said she disconnected electronic devices in the home to hide his presence. Police say they had responded to multiple domestic violence calls from Michele Neurauter's residence in Corning, New York before her death.
Karrie Neurauter a computer engineering student at Rochester Institute of Technology in New York says her dad gave her an ultimatum in August — saying she could help him kill her mother or he would commit suicide.
